How they compare
Colombia currently reports 21.6% against 21.4% in Ecuador, a difference of 0.2%.
The two have swapped places 25 times across 60 shared years of data; in 1966 it was Ecuador ahead.
Colombia ranks 13th and Ecuador ranks 14th of 80 countries.
Across the 7 decades both report, Colombia averaged higher in 3 and Ecuador in 4.
Head to head by decade
| Decade | Colombia | Ecuador | Difference | Ahead |
|---|---|---|---|---|
| 1960s | 11.3% | 10.0% | 1.3% | Colombia |
| 1970s | 9.9% | 7.9% | 2.0% | Colombia |
| 1980s | 7.2% | 25.3% | 18.1% | Ecuador |
| 1990s | 3.1% | 4.4% | 1.4% | Ecuador |
| 2000s | 3.2% | 4.0% | 0.8% | Ecuador |
| 2010s | 4.3% | 11.0% | 6.8% | Ecuador |
| 2020s | 5.2% | 2.5% | 2.7% | Colombia |
Averages of every year both report within each decade.
